Photography  is the process, activity and art of creating still or moving pictures by recording radiation on a sensitive medium, such as a photographic film, or an electronic sensor. It is also a unique and creative medium of self-expression and an art form requiring aesthetic sense as well as technical expertise. It is a hobby that can be made profitable by going professional by the talented. Photography is a medium for various business, science, art, and pleasure activities. Scientists have used photography to record and study human and animal locomotion. Military, police, and security forces use photography for surveillance, recognition and data storage. Photography is used by amateurs to preserve memories and as a source of entertainment. Photography has become ubiquitous in recording events and data in science and engineering, and at crime scenes or accident scenes. Photographers are creative individuals think and communicate in visual terms. They interpret a client’s needs, translating their ideas into images that work.

Some of its specialized fields are -

  • Press Photography - Photography meant for the national and local press.
  • Feature Photography - It covers various aspects like people at home, or life in foreign parts, or schools at work, anything that makes a story.
  • Editorial Photography - It is required for magazines and periodicals to pictorially illustrate what is written in the article or report.
  • Commercial / Industrial Photography - It deals with taking  pictures of merchandise, exteriors and interiors of factories, and machinery both indoors and outdoors to be used for company brochures, annual reports, and in advertising and selling.
  • Portrait / Wedding Photography - It deals with portrait subjects like pets, children, families, weddings, functions and activities of sports and social clubs.
  • Advertising Photography - It's area of work includes catalogue work, mail order etc.
  • Fashion Photography - It deals with covering creations of fashion houses or advertising agencies.
  • Fine Arts Photography - This type of photography deals with photographs which are of high technical proficiency, artistic talent and creativity.
  • Digital Photography - It involves the exclusive use of a digital camera for use in various businesses.
  • Nature and Wildlife Photography - It involves taking photographs of animals, birds, plants and landscapes. These maybe used for calendars, covers etc.
  • Forensic Photography - It deals with photographing a crime scene from every angle clearly to show detail, with the emphasis on accurately recording the size and distance of objects.
  • Freelancing Photography - It deals with covering any or all specialised fields of photography. A Freelancer is self-employed individual with business management skills.

Basic Requirement

Academic Qualification - There are no specific academic requirements for full time courses in photography, however, candidates who have cleared the 10+2 exam are eligible for the diploma/certificate courses in photography. There are many students who learn photography along with their college degree, doing a part-time course. Besides the Certificate and Diploma courses in the field, Photography is also offered as an optional subject for a bachelor's degree in Fine arts. Some institutes offer full fledged B.A courses in photography of three year duration. Besides the academic requirements, having a background in computers or electronics, related work experience and training is beneficial for making a break in the field.

Personal Traits - Being a creative medium, photography requires more of inherent talent for success than formal training. However training hones the inherent skills and help to shine in this competitive field. One should have a definite know how of the angle, lighting, latest equipments and technology to make a name in the field. Photography basically requires a keen, observant eye, and an intelligent, curious and perceptive mind. A photographer must have full knowledge and command over the variety of cameras, lights and props, and all kinds of photographic techniques

Job Perspectives

Photography is a field which has the most exciting aspect owing to to the variety of jobs available in the market. These range from highly specialized, technical work to jobs that require creativity and Visual literacy. The gargantuan growth of communication network, advertising, media, fashion and revolution of the digital photography has increased the commercial value of the profession. Beginners can be an assistant of a senior or professional photographer to grasp the finer points of photography. Various government departments require the service of photographers on a regular pay scale to do general photography documentation, for covering day-to-day events and functions and for making photo features and captioning. Fashion photographers can find employment with designers, fashion journals and news papers. Fashion photography is the most highly paid and is generally carried out in either Mumbai or Delhi. It involves highly sophisticated and well-equipped studios by freelancers who are commissioned by fashion houses of advertising agencies.

Remuneration - Photographers working as assistants to senior photographers may earn somewhere around Rs. 3,500 - 6,000 and higher. Depending upon the designation and the organisation one earn up to 25,000, upon becoming a veteran.
